Question Without Notice No. 712 asked in the Legislative Council on 14 September 2021 by Hon Peter Collier

Parliament: 41 Session: 1

METHAMPHETAMINE — WASTEWATER TESTING

712. Hon PETER COLLIER to the minister representing the Minister for Police:

(1) Will the minister confirm that the methamphetamine consumption rate in Western Australia is determined through wastewater testing?

(2) If no to (1), how is it determined?

(3) If yes to (1), what was the percentage of meth consumption in Western Australia in 2017, 2018, 2019 and 2020?

Hon STEPHEN DAWSON replied:

I thank the honourable member for some notice of the question. The following information has been provided to me by the Minister for Police.

The Western Australia Police Force advises —

(1) The WA Police Force confirms this methodology is used to determine methamphetamine consumption through wastewater testing.

(2) Not applicable.

(3) The Western Australia Police Force does not report on the percentage of meth consumed in Western Australia. The Australian Criminal Intelligence Commission oversees the National Wastewater Drug Monitoring Program and produces a series of public reports that provide datasets of drug use and distribution patterns across capital cities and regional Australia.
